[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: удалить загрузчик grub с диска



On Wed, Dec 24, 2008 at 04:05:27AM +0300, George Shuklin wrote:
> > > Дурацкий вопрос - как удалить загрузчик grub'а с диска?!
> > >
> > > Проблема: вытащил из ноута винчестер на котором стоял линукс. Запихал в 
> > > коробочку. Отформатировал. Но забыл пересоздать партиции. Отчего теперь если 
> > > забываюсь и втыкаю винчестер в коробочке раньше времени с него начинается бут 
> > > в тот груб который там раньше стоял.
> > >
> > > Как удалить этот загрузчик?
> > >
> >    Надо затереть MBR "master boot record".
> >    Проще всего досовским fdisk \mbr,
> >    или в win в "recovery console" fixmbr.
> >    Можно и с помощью dd, что то типа
> >    dd if=/dev/zero of=/dev/sd? bs=446 count=1
> >    Только сначала спасите первые 512 байт куда нибудь,
> >    dd if=/dev/sd? of=backup.mbr bs=512 count=1
> >    а то там ещё партишен находится (следующие 64 байта
> >    и 2 байта на magic number). Если вдруг что не
> >    так, то хоть восстановить можно будет.
> >    Ю.
> 
> и MBR, и Partition Table находятся в первых 512 байтах нулевого сектора диска.

Дык, Юра об этом и пишет. 446 = 01BEh -- с этого смещения начинается
таблица разделов. Только насколько я помню, в самом начале сектора еще
есть описатель носителя (его в коде загрузчика обычно jmp обходит).
Безопасно ли его забить нулями, честно говоря, не помню =)

-- 
Stanislav


Reply to: